As published

This recipe was extracted from The Cook County cook book (1912) by Associated College Women Workers, page 282. The excerpt below is the record exactly as published.

2 cups mashed potatoes, 2 table- spoons melted butter, 2 eggs, whipped light, 1 cup cream or milk, salt to taste
